Technical Enablement Manager
Lenovo is a global technology powerhouse focused on delivering Smarter Technology for All. The Technical Enablement Manager will bridge the gap between engineering, product development, and field operations by transforming Lenovo’s Hybrid Cloud and AI-enabled Solutions into tangible, field-ready technical assets.

Responsibilities
Technical Enablement: Define a global enablement strategy, ensuring consistent technical readiness across geographies and partner channels. Mentor regional enablement leads to drive excellence and alignment
Solution Engineering Demos: Architect scalable, multi-solution demo frameworks that integrate seamlessly with partner ecosystems and cloud alliances to showcase Lenovo’s capabilities
Proof of Concept Field Support: Establish and govern PoC standards, ensuring scalability and repeatability. Develop frameworks that enable consistent and successful field execution
Technical Content Creation: Lead the global technical content strategy, overseeing the development of accurate, scalable, and go-to-market-aligned assets including guides, blueprints, configuration briefs, whitepapers, technical blogs, and presentations. Create hands-on labs and demos for tradeshows, workshops, conferences, and similar events
Field Partner Readiness: Design global technical enablement programs, including curriculum development, certification paths, and performance metrics
Competitive Performance Benchmarking: Direct competitive intelligence validation and shape technical differentiation narratives. Help develop technical claims to differentiate offerings
Feedback Loop to Engineering: Drive structured feedback channels and represent customer voice in offering roadmap reviews
Thought Leadership: Serve as technical evangelist in analyst briefings, conferences, and industry consortiums
Act as the technical point-of-contact for Beta customers, supporting their onboarding and feedback processes
Qualification
Required
12+ years of experience technical pre-sales, solution engineering, or technical marketing, ideally across multiple GEOs
Solid understanding of Hybrid Cloud, infrastructure modernization, virtualization, automation, and AI workloads
Preferred
Hands-on experience with Lenovo or equivalent OEM technologies (VMware, Nutanix, Azure Stack, Red Hat, Kubernetes, etc.)
Skilled in lab/demo design, technical documentation, and field enablement delivery
Excellent written, visual, and verbal communication skills (translating complex to simple)
Proven leadership of technical enablement programs or global solution frameworks
Influencer in technical communities (speaker, author, advisor)
Strong stakeholder influence across engineering, portfolio, and field organizations
Experience managing or mentoring technical teams
